some advice, when you ask people if they like your new perfume, or if they like your haircut, or if they like something you just bought, there are very good odds they will say yes, regardless of their real feelings for it. Particularly women, which have ingrained this wanting to please social instincts.

This woman loathes sauvage. But I would never say so to somebody wearing it, who seems like they might like it. It feels really impolite to tell somebody you hate something they like.
